WebC#进阶学习--虚方法(virtual) C#进阶学习--抽象方法(abstract) C#进阶学习--扩展方法(this) C#进阶学习--反射(Reflection) 最后,其实所有的数据测试可以在[云服务器]进行,大家可以看看的相关服务,买来作为测试数据的服务器非常不错,最低只要38一年 WebMar 5, 2013 · This property accepts an index argument (there is an overload of PropertyInfo.GetValue that accept an object array, just like MethodInfo.Invoke) and returns the object at that position. int index = /* the index you want to get here */; PropertyInfo indexer = Object.GetProperty ("Item"); object item = indexer.GetValue (Object, new …
C# 反射(Reflection)详解_c#中reflectmessage_Dragon_9527的 …
WebExample 1: C# Reflection to get Assembly . The Type class provides a property called Assembly which generates the Assembly of the code. For example, using System; using … Web또한, 어떤 객체를 받아들여 해당 타입을 얻은 후에 (ex: obj.GetType ()), 이 타입의 또 다른 객체를 생성하는 것도 가능하다. 아래의 예제는 해당 Customer라는 클래스명을 사용하여 … coviran granada basket
C# Reflection (With Examples)
Implementing reflection in C#requires a two-step process. You first get the “type” object, then use the type to browse members such as “methods” and “properties.” This is how you would create instances of DateTime class from the system assembly: To access the sample class Calculator from Test.dll assembly, the … See more To understand reflection, there are a few basics you should understand about modules, types, and members: 1. Assemblies contain modules 2. Modules contain types 3. Types contain members You need to use … See more There are several uses including: 1. Use Module to get all global and non-global methods defined in the module. 2. Use MethodInfo to look at … See more Reflection can be used to create applications called type browsers which allow users to select types and then read the data provided … See more The main class for reflection is the System.Type class, which is an abstract class representing a type in the Common Type System(CTS). … See more Web첫 댓글을 남겨보세요 공유하기 ... WebOct 9, 2024 · 가장 유용한 Reflection 기능중 하나는 Type 을 가지고 해당 인스턴스를 만드는 것이다. 하지만 보편적인 Activator.CreateInstance()는 매우 느리다. 그럴 땐 Expression 을 … covi sas